This is the time of year in which things really click for the girls’ cross country team at South Winneshiek.
The Warriors invariably peak in time for the state-qualifying meet, and ultimately the state championships.
South Winn takes a No. 2 ranking into its Class 1A state-qualifier Thursday at Mason City.
The state field will be completed Thursday; 2A and 1A meets are statewide. In 2A, the top three teams and the top 15 individuals advance from each site to Fort Dodge next weekend. In 1A, it’s the top two teams and 10 runners from each site.
Here is a primer on where the area’s top teams and individuals are running Thursday:
